CVE-2025-24198
Apple Siri Locked Device Data Access Vulnerability
Description

This issue was addressed by restricting options offered on a locked device. This issue is fixed in macOS Ventura 13.7.5, iOS 18.4 and iPadOS 18.4, iPadOS 17.7.6, macOS Sequoia 15.4, macOS Sonoma 14.7.5. An attacker with physical access may be able to use Siri to access sensitive user data.
